Introducing No.47 New Street, which is a charming, mid-terraced period property, located within the historic market town of Ludlow, surrounded by glorious Shropshire countryside and positioned approximately 0.75 miles from the vibrant town centre with its many independently owned shops, cafés, restaurants and facilities.

Situated within a popular residential area, No.47 New Street offers well-maintained accommodation throughout and is available with no onward chain. Combining character features, generous outside space and distant countryside views from the first floor, this delightful home could be ideal for first time buyers, downsizers, investors or those seeking a buy-to-let opportunity within one of Shropshire’s most desirable towns. Inside, the accommodation spans across 2 floors and has been thoughtfully maintained by the current owners.

The front door opens into a welcoming living room, which enjoys plenty of natural light and features an attractive brick fireplace, creating a warm and inviting focal point. Leading through to the rear of the property is the kitchen/dining room, fitted with a range of base and wall units, work surfaces and space for appliances, whilst also offering ample room for dining and entertaining. A rear door provides direct access out to the garden and stairs rise up to the first floor.

On the first floor, the landing area gives way to the bathroom and both bedrooms. Bedroom one is a generous double room positioned to the front of the property, enjoying distant countryside views, while the second bedroom enjoys a pleasant outlook over the rear garden. The bathroom is fitted with a matching suite comprising bath with shower over, wash basin and W.C.

Outside, the property benefits from a sizeable, south-west facing rear garden which is a particularly attractive feature of the home. The garden is predominantly laid to lawn with established borders, mature planting and a number of seating areas positioned to enjoy the surroundings. A paved patio adjoining the rear of the property provides the perfect space for outdoor dining and relaxation during the warmer months of the year. A useful garden store further enhances the practicality of the outside space. There is no designated parking, however there is unrestricted parking directly out front on New Street.
